COMMENTS:

Discontinued in mid-2003, this was widely regarded as one of the best lenses Canon have ever made. Very sharp and very fast, ideal for low-light sports work and candid portraits.

I don't know why it was discontinued, perhaps because the number of people who could really use it was small and so maybe it didn't sell to well. The price was around $4000, so I think a lot of people probably bought the 200/2.8L USM for around $650 instead.
